7ac99be6e2 x86: Add an ICH6 pin configuration driver
Add a driver which sets up the pin configuration on x86 devices with an ICH6
(or later) Platform Controller Hub.

The driver is not in the pinctrl uclass due to some oddities of the way x86
devices work:

- The GPIO controller is not present in I/O space until it is set up
- This is done by writing a register in the PCH
- The PCH has a driver which itself uses PCI, another driver
- The pinctrl uclass requires that a pinctrl device be available before any
other device can be probed

It would be possible to work around the limitations by:
- Hard-coding the GPIO address rather than reading it from the PCH
- Using special x86 PCI access to set the GPIO address in the PCH

However it is not clear that this is better, since the pin configuration
driver does not actually provide normal pin configuration services - it
simply sets up all the pins statically when probed. While this remains the
case, it seems better to use a syscon uclass instead. This can be probed
whenever it is needed, without any limitations.

Also add an 'invert' property to support inverting the input.

Alexander Graf
50149ea37a efi_loader: Add runtime services
After booting has finished, EFI allows firmware to still interact with the OS
using the "runtime services". These callbacks live in a separate address space,
since they are available long after U-Boot has been overwritten by the OS.

This patch adds enough framework for arbitrary code inside of U-Boot to become
a runtime service with the right section attributes set. For now, we don't make
use of it yet though.

We could maybe in the future map U-boot environment variables to EFI variables
here.

Alexander Graf
5e2ec773bb arm64: Make full va map code more dynamic
The idea to generate our pages tables from an array of memory ranges
is very sound. However, instead of hard coding the code to create up
to 2 levels of 64k granule page tables, we really should just create
normal 4k page tables that allow us to set caching attributes on 2M
or 4k level later on.

So this patch moves the full_va mapping code to 4k page size and
makes it fully flexible to dynamically create as many levels as
necessary for a map (including dynamic 1G/2M pages). It also adds
support to dynamically split a large map into smaller ones when
some code wants to set dcache attributes.

With all this in place, there is very little reason to create your
own page tables in board specific files.

Lokesh Vutla
0bea813d00 ARM: omap-common: Add standard access for board description EEPROM
Several TI EVMs have EEPROM that can contain board description information
such as revision, DDR definition, serial number, etc. In just about all
cases, these EEPROM are on the I2C bus and provides us the opportunity
to centralize the generic operations involved.

The on-board EEPROM on the BeagleBone Black, BeagleBone, AM335x EVM,
AM43x GP EVM, AM57xx-evm, BeagleBoard-X15 share the same format.
However, DRA-7* EVMs, OMAP4SDP use a modified format.

We hence introduce logic which is generic between these platforms
without enforcing any specific format. This allows the boards to use the
relevant format for operations that they might choose.

This module will compile for all TI SoC based boards when
CONFIG_TI_I2C_BOARD_DETECT is enabled to have optimal build times for
platforms that require this support.

It is important to note that this logic is fundamental to the board
configuration process such as DDR configuration which is needed in
SPL, hence cannot be part of the standard u-boot driver model (which
is available later in the process). Hence, to aid efficiency, the
eeprom contents are copied over to SRAM scratchpad memory area at the
first invocation to retrieve data.

To prevent churn with cases such as DRA7, where eeprom format maybe
incompatible, we introduce a generic common format in eeprom which
is made available over accessor functions for usage.

Special handling for BBG1 EEPROM had to be introduced thanks to the
weird eeprom rev contents used.

The follow on patches introduce the use of this library for AM335x,
AM437x, and AM57xx.

Peng Fan
35c4ce5e20 imx: mx7d: isolate resources to domain 0 for A7 core
In current design, if any peripheral was assigned to both A7 and M4,
it will receive ipg_stop or ipg_wait when any of the 2 platforms
enter low power mode. We will have a risk that, if A7 enter wait,
M4 enter stop, peripheral will have chance to get ipg_stop and ipg_wait
asserted same time. Also if M4 enters stop mode, A7 will have no
chance to access the peripheral.
There are 26 peripherals affected by this IC issue:
SIM2(sim2/emvsim2)
SIM1(sim1/emvsim1)
UART1/UART2/UART3/UART4/UART5/UART6/UART7
SAI1/SAI2/SAI3
WDOG1/WDOG2/WDOG3/WDOG4
GPT1/GPT2/GPT3/GPT4
PWM1/PWM2/PWM3/PWM4
ENET1/ENET2
Software Workaround:
The solution is to set the peripherals to Domain0 by A core, since A core
in Domain0. The peripherals which will be used by M4, will be set to Domain1
by M4.
For example, A core set WDOG4 to domain0, but when M4 boots up, M4 will
set WDOG4 to domain1, because M4 will use WDOG4.

So the peripherals are not shared by them. This way requires
the uboot implemented the RDC driver and set the 26 IPs above
to domain 0 only. M4 image will set the M4 to domain 1 and
set peripheral which it will use to domain 1.

This patch enables the CONFIG_IMX_RDC and CONFIG_IMX_BOOTAUX for
i.MX7D SABRESD board, and setup the 26 IP resources to domain 0.

Bin Meng
dc5be508b0 x86: fsp: Make sure HOB list is not overwritten by U-Boot
Intel IvyBridge FSP seems to be buggy that it does not report memory
used by FSP itself as reserved in the resource descriptor HOB. The
FSP specification does not describe how resource descriptor HOBs are
generated by the FSP to describe what memory regions. It looks newer
FSPs like Queensbay and BayTrail do not have such issue. This causes
U-Boot relocation overwrites the important boot service data which is
used by FSP, and the subsequent call to fsp_notify() will fail.

To resolve this, we find out the lowest memory base address allocated
by FSP for the boot service data when walking through the HOB list in
fsp_get_usable_lowmem_top(). Check whether the memory top address is
below the FSP HOB list, and if not, use the lowest memory base address
allocated by FSP as the memory top address.

Alexey Brodkin
379b3280b3 arc: cache - accommodate different L1 cache line lengths
ARC core could be configured with different L1 and L2 (AKA SLC) cache
line lengths. At least these values are possible and were really used:
32, 64 or 128 bytes.

Current implementation requires cache line to be selected upon U-Boot
configuration and then it will only work on matching hardware. Indeed
this is quite efficient because cache line length gets hardcoded during
code compilation. But OTOH it makes binary less portable.

With this commit we allow U-Boot to determine real L1 cache line length
early in runtime and use this value later on. This extends portability
of U-Boot binary a lot.
